From 55da782025f5728051fea9fff49f9e6b6f602a1e Mon Sep 17 00:00:00 2001 From: fengxiang <110431245@qq.com> Date: Thu, 28 Dec 2017 17:31:15 +0800 Subject: [PATCH] 设备信息模块 --- src/app/core/services/example.service.ts | 9 ++++----- 1 files changed, 4 insertions(+), 5 deletions(-) diff --git a/src/app/core/services/example.service.ts b/src/app/core/services/example.service.ts index 823a581..9d32660 100644 --- a/src/app/core/services/example.service.ts +++ b/src/app/core/services/example.service.ts @@ -1,23 +1,22 @@ import { Injectable } from '@angular/core'; -import { Column } from '@core/entity/grid'; export class Criteria{ - private static CONDITION_SPLIT = "||"; + private static CONDITION_SPLIT = '||'; private conditions: string[] = []; public getConditions(): string[]{ return this.conditions; } public addCondition(condition: string,colName:string,...values: any[]){ - const split = Criteria.CONDITION_SPLIT;//'||' + const split = Criteria.CONDITION_SPLIT; // '||' this.conditions.push(condition+split+colName+split+ values.join(split)); } - public andLike(col:Column): Criteria{ + public andLike(col: { name: string, value: any}): Criteria{ this.addCondition('andLike',col.name,col.value); return this; } - public andEqualTo(col:Column): Criteria{ + public andEqualTo(col: { name: string, value: any}): Criteria{ this.addCondition('andEqualTo',col.name,col.value); return this; } -- Gitblit v1.8.0